Signal:
The Dutch based, CRAFT Consortium - Respect Farms -is building the world’s first cultivated meat farm, embedding bioreactors into working agricultural systems. This hybrid approach positions farmers as central actors in cellular agriculture, reducing environmental impacts while providing a pathway for rural resilience. For ANZ, the model is particularly relevant: farmers here already operate at export scale, but cultivated farms could allow them to monetise expertise, land, and co-products in new ways, while buffering against declining red meat demand.
Human Factor:
Farmers are being asked to join the cellular future, not be displaced by it. EU based, CRAFT reframes cultivated meat from “lab-based disruption” into “farm-based evolution.” For ANZ communities reliant on sheep and beef, the shift could feel less threatening and more like diversification, offering a pragmatic on-ramp for the next generation of producers.
